Fennec F-Droid: do not remove gcc
The build system gives clang a higher priority.
This commit is contained in:
parent
77e5603316
commit
bf32ac3b4b
|
@ -8229,12 +8229,10 @@ Builds:
|
||||||
timeout: 28800
|
timeout: 28800
|
||||||
sudo:
|
sudo:
|
||||||
- apt-get update || apt-get update
|
- apt-get update || apt-get update
|
||||||
- apt-get purge gcc
|
|
||||||
- apt-get install -y clang-6.0 llvm-6.0 libgmp-dev libmpfr-dev libmpc-dev
|
- apt-get install -y clang-6.0 llvm-6.0 libgmp-dev libmpfr-dev libmpc-dev
|
||||||
- update-alternatives --install /usr/bin/clang clang /usr/bin/clang-6.0 100
|
- update-alternatives --install /usr/bin/clang clang /usr/bin/clang-6.0 100
|
||||||
- update-alternatives --install /usr/bin/clang++ clang++ /usr/bin/clang++-6.0
|
- update-alternatives --install /usr/bin/clang++ clang++ /usr/bin/clang++-6.0
|
||||||
100
|
100
|
||||||
- update-alternatives --install /usr/bin/cc cc /usr/bin/clang 100
|
|
||||||
output: obj/dist/fennec-$$VERSION$$.multi.android-*-unsigned-unaligned.apk
|
output: obj/dist/fennec-$$VERSION$$.multi.android-*-unsigned-unaligned.apk
|
||||||
srclibs:
|
srclibs:
|
||||||
- MozLocales@6579be0691dd6da2d589e2d8ceaa0c9b4c6ef5b6
|
- MozLocales@6579be0691dd6da2d589e2d8ceaa0c9b4c6ef5b6
|
||||||
|
@ -8280,12 +8278,10 @@ Builds:
|
||||||
timeout: 28800
|
timeout: 28800
|
||||||
sudo:
|
sudo:
|
||||||
- apt-get update || apt-get update
|
- apt-get update || apt-get update
|
||||||
- apt-get purge gcc
|
|
||||||
- apt-get install -y clang-6.0 llvm-6.0 libgmp-dev libmpfr-dev libmpc-dev
|
- apt-get install -y clang-6.0 llvm-6.0 libgmp-dev libmpfr-dev libmpc-dev
|
||||||
- update-alternatives --install /usr/bin/clang clang /usr/bin/clang-6.0 100
|
- update-alternatives --install /usr/bin/clang clang /usr/bin/clang-6.0 100
|
||||||
- update-alternatives --install /usr/bin/clang++ clang++ /usr/bin/clang++-6.0
|
- update-alternatives --install /usr/bin/clang++ clang++ /usr/bin/clang++-6.0
|
||||||
100
|
100
|
||||||
- update-alternatives --install /usr/bin/cc cc /usr/bin/clang 100
|
|
||||||
output: obj/dist/fennec-$$VERSION$$.multi.android-*-unsigned-unaligned.apk
|
output: obj/dist/fennec-$$VERSION$$.multi.android-*-unsigned-unaligned.apk
|
||||||
srclibs:
|
srclibs:
|
||||||
- MozLocales@6579be0691dd6da2d589e2d8ceaa0c9b4c6ef5b6
|
- MozLocales@6579be0691dd6da2d589e2d8ceaa0c9b4c6ef5b6
|
||||||
|
@ -8331,12 +8327,10 @@ Builds:
|
||||||
timeout: 28800
|
timeout: 28800
|
||||||
sudo:
|
sudo:
|
||||||
- apt-get update || apt-get update
|
- apt-get update || apt-get update
|
||||||
- apt-get purge gcc
|
|
||||||
- apt-get install -y clang-6.0 llvm-6.0 libgmp-dev libmpfr-dev libmpc-dev
|
- apt-get install -y clang-6.0 llvm-6.0 libgmp-dev libmpfr-dev libmpc-dev
|
||||||
- update-alternatives --install /usr/bin/clang clang /usr/bin/clang-6.0 100
|
- update-alternatives --install /usr/bin/clang clang /usr/bin/clang-6.0 100
|
||||||
- update-alternatives --install /usr/bin/clang++ clang++ /usr/bin/clang++-6.0
|
- update-alternatives --install /usr/bin/clang++ clang++ /usr/bin/clang++-6.0
|
||||||
100
|
100
|
||||||
- update-alternatives --install /usr/bin/cc cc /usr/bin/clang 100
|
|
||||||
output: obj/dist/fennec-$$VERSION$$.multi.android-*-unsigned-unaligned.apk
|
output: obj/dist/fennec-$$VERSION$$.multi.android-*-unsigned-unaligned.apk
|
||||||
srclibs:
|
srclibs:
|
||||||
- MozLocales@6579be0691dd6da2d589e2d8ceaa0c9b4c6ef5b6
|
- MozLocales@6579be0691dd6da2d589e2d8ceaa0c9b4c6ef5b6
|
||||||
|
|
Loading…
Reference in a new issue